The North Carolina Department of Commerce is seeking two Nc Workforce Credentials Fellows to enhance workforce development strategies and ensure accessibility for target populations. These full-time, time-limited positions offer a hybrid work schedule and involve collaborating with various stakeholders to implement effective credentialing processes
Job Summary
These positions will address issues of quality and accessibility for target populations in strategy development and implementation, ensuring relevance and quality outcomes.
Responsibilities include coordinating with employers, industry associations, and education partners to revise credential criteria, update the application process, and develop outreach campaigns.
The State of North Carolina offers competitive benefits including health insurance, retirement plans, paid holidays, and leave accrual.
